#CC196D Color
#CC196D is rgb(204, 25, 109) in RGB, hsl(332, 78%, 45%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 88%, 47%, 20%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Telemagenta (#CF3476),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.93.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#CC196D Channel Values
How #CC196D bre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 204 · G 25 · B 109 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 332° · S 78% · L 45%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 332° · S 88% · V 80%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 88% · Y 47% · K 20%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 5.35:1 vs white · 3.93: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#CC196D background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#CC196D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#CC196D?
#CC196D is a mid-tone pink — rgb(204, 25, 109) in RGB and hsl(332, 78%, 45%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Telemagenta (#CF3476),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.93.
What is the RGB value of #CC196D?
#CC196D is rgb(204, 25, 109) — red 204, green 25, and blue 109 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#CC196D?
#CC196D conver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 88%, 47%, 20%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#CC196D be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#CC196D scores 5.35:1 against white and 3.93: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#CC196D as a CSS color keyword?
No. #CC196D is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umvioletred (#C71585) at a CIE76 distance of 15.76, which is visibly different.
